Development and Communications Director

Santa Barbara Hillel

Role Overview

The Development and Communications Director at Santa Barbara Hillel in Isla Vista CA will direct a multi-pronged institutional advancement strategy that will generate support to enhance the experience of 3000 students at UC Santa Barbara and Santa Barbara City College. Santa Barbara Hillel enriches the lives of students through diverse Jewish community and cultural programming and robust Israel engagement. The Development and Communications Director will report to and be a strategic thought partner with the Executive Director. The primary responsibilities of the Development and Communications Director will be to oversee and direct our annual fundraising campaign manage our major gifts and grassroots fundraising manage our community-facing communications channels and organize our annual fundraising brunch and other special events.

What Youll Do

Donor & Stakeholder Management

  • Lead the creation and execution of an annual development plan backed by strong systems for tracking goals and progress.
  • Identify research and generate donor foundation and major gift prospects by mining alumni lists past donor data and Board and community networks and partner with the Executive Director to cultivate these relationships.
  • Develop and implement stewardship plans for all donors.
  • Cultivate strong relationships with current parents and serve as a primary point of contact providing clear and timely communication across multiple channels.
  • Develop alumni and regional networks.

Data and Systems Management

  • Ensure donor data and interactions are accurately captured in the Little Green Light (LGL) database and congruous record-keeping exists across the development and financial operations.
  • Manage lists for special attention by the Executive Director members of the Board of Trustees and the Development Committee.

Event Management

  • Direct Hillels annual parent events including events during UCSBs Move-In/Welcome Week and Parents/Family Weekend.
  • Organize Hillels fundraising events from our existing Hall of Fame major fundraiser to parlor meetings and future events you will help envision and execute.

Communications

  • Oversee the strategy and execution of the annual campaign including grassroots fundraising efforts such as direct mail and digital appeals.
  • Create and manage a robust digital marketing strategy including designing content sourced from stakeholders (e.g. students staff).
  • Oversee Annual Report.

Board & Volunteer Management

  • Convene and staff the Community Engagement and Development Committee of the Board of Trustees.
  • Assist Executive Director in prospecting coordinating and supporting the Board of Trustees.

Organizational Leadership

  • Contribute to organization-wide strategy and management.
  • Occasionally represent the organization to key stakeholders including Federations Foundations and community organizations.
  • Supervise development intern(s).

Additional Responsibilities

  • Attend Hillel programs on evenings and weekends as necessary such as select Friday night Shabbat dinners some High Holiday events Parent/Family Weekend etc.
  • Travel as necessary for donor meetings cultivation events conferences etc. particularly in Southern California.

About Hillel International

In 1923 Rabbi Benjamin Frankel started Hillel with humble means a noble mission and a breathtaking vision: to convey Jewish civilization to a new generation. Today Hillel International continues to enrich the lives of Jewish students and is the largest Jewish campus organization in the world at nearly 1000 colleges and universities across North America and around the world. As Hillel evolves as an organization the mission remains steadfast: to create lasting connections with every Jewish student that foster an enduring commitment to Jewish life learning and Israel and train them to become the next Jewish leaders.
